'Real Housewives' Husband Gets New Trial Date

Giuseppe 'Joe' Giudice now scheduled to appear in court on Oct. 28, reports say.

After another delay in the fraudulent ID trial of Giuseppe "Joe" Giudice, the "Real Housewives of New Jersey" star was given a new trial date when he appeared in court Monday, according to a news report.

While the husband of the hit Bravo show's Teresa Giudice did appear in the court room on Monday, the date his trial was scheduled to begin, his lawyer, Miles Feinsten requested a new trial date as he is occupied with a high-profile homicide case in Sussex County, the attorney told a judge. State Superior Court Judge Greta Gooden Brown set a new date of Oct. 28 for pre-trial conferences, according to The Record.

Giudice, a 43-year-old Towaco resident, was arrested in 2010 after authorities claimed he attempted to use his brother's information to obtain a new driver's license when his own was suspended for DWI charges.
